Geography
Location
Southeastern Asia, archipelago between the Philippine Sea and the South China Sea, east of Vietnam
Area:
total: 300,000 sq km
land: 298,170 sq km
water: 1,830 sq km
Climate:
tropical marine; northeast monsoon (November to April); southwest monsoon (May to October)
Natural Resources:
timber, petroleum, nickel, cobalt, silver, gold, salt, copper
Natural hazards:
astride typhoon belt, usually affected by 15 and struck by five to six cyclonic storms per year; landslides; active volcanoes; destructive earthquakes; tsunamis
Environment - current issues:
uncontrolled deforestation in watershed areas; soil erosion; air and water pollution in Manila; increasing pollution of coastal mangrove swamps which are important fish breeding grounds
